Abia To Pay Years Of Unsettled Salaries

The Abia State Government has revealed plans to pay salary arrears owed to former Local Government councillors who served between 1999 and 2022.

 

Governor Alex Otti disclosed the decision as part of efforts to address long-standing financial obligations.

 

He explained that many of the affected officials had waited years for their entitlements, adding that the state would begin steps to verify and process the payments.

 

The move, he said, is aimed at correcting past lapses and restoring trust.

 

The government noted that settling the arrears would bring relief to former councillors who were left out of previous payment arrangements.

 

Officials said relevant records would be reviewed to ensure accuracy before funds are released.

 

The announcement signals the administration’s intention to tidy up inherited liabilities while reassuring former public office holders that their claims will not be ignored.
